The United Schools Network (USN) is a nonprofit organization in Columbus, Ohio. After founding its first school in 2008, it has worked together with incredible leaders to open three more schools in the span of ten years. Each USN school is an open enrollment, public charter school that works diligently to close the opportunity gap in Columbus. Moreover, the mission of all USN schools is to transform lives and our communities through the power of education, while maintaining our vision: For every child, an open door. 

USN currently operates two high-performing elementary schools (K-5) and two high-performing middle schools (6-8) that serve more than 1,000 students. We strive to provide students with a rigorous academic experience in a joyful learning environment, and we work hard to ensure that students of all levels grow and succeed by focusing on intentional student support and continual improvement. 

Position Description 

The Stewardship Associate (SA) position is a unique opportunity for talented individuals to pursue their interest in fundraising while honing their administrative skills to support the development team at United Schools Network. This individual will manage donor and volunteer stewardship efforts, will support volunteer and programmatic work at our schools, and will assist the team with key board stewardship and staff relations tasks. This will include coordinating and executing a number of tasks related to school board governance. Additionally, the SA will thrive in the areas of organization and detail-orientation and demonstrate this through their ability to maintain accurate records and reports using the team’s various development platforms and systems. Lastly, this position takes an active role in managing the team’s social media platforms and website as well as in executing the network’s communication strategy.
